#06428b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#06428b is composed of 2.4% red, 25.9%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.7% cyan, 52.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 212.9 degrees, a saturation of 91.7% and a lightness of 28.4%. #06428b color hex could be obtained by blending #0c84ff with #000017.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

● #06428b color description : Dark blue.
#06428b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#06428b has RGB values of R:6, G:66, B:139 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 410251.
